Lilburn is a town in Georgia with about 15,000 residents. It grades B+ for weather and F for affordability. Standout strengths include natural disaster risk, walkability, and airport distance. It rates lower on air quality and cost of living.
- The median home value in Lilburn is $258k, per the U.S. Census ACS (5-Year).
- Median household income in Lilburn is $61k, per the U.S. Census ACS (5-Year).
- Median gross rent in Lilburn is $1k a month, per the U.S. Census ACS (5-Year).
- Lilburn has a violent crime rate of 714/100k, per the FBI Uniform Crime Reports.
- The average one-way commute in Lilburn is 30 min, per the U.S. Census ACS (5-Year).

Frequently asked questions
- Is Lilburn an affordable place to live?
- Lilburn is relatively expensive. Its cost-of-living index is $63k, better than 9% of comparable areas. Median rent is $1k.
- Is Lilburn safe?
- Lilburn is about average for safety comparable areas, with a violent crime rate of 714/100k (better than 51%). Property crime is 2187/100k.
- What is the weather like in Lilburn?
- Lilburn averages 80°F in July and 43°F in January, with 53.5 in of annual precipitation and about 258 sunny days a year.
- How are the schools in Lilburn?
- Public-school quality in Lilburn is below average, scoring better than 25% of comparable areas on a composite of graduation rates, spending, and student-teacher ratio.
- How long is the commute in Lilburn?
- The average one-way commute in Lilburn is 30 min.
